Specifications

Brand Fender
Category 4-string Bass Guitars
Number of Strings: 4,
Left-/Right-handed: Right-handed,
Body Shape: Vintera '50s Precision, Precision,
Body Material: Alder,
Body Finish: Gloss Polyester,
Color: Sea Foam Green, Dakota Red,
Neck Material: Maple,
Neck Shape: Vintage C,
Radius: 7.25",
Fingerboard Material: Maple,
Fingerboard Inlay: Black Dots,
Number of Frets: 20,
Scale Length: 34",
Nut Width: 1.75",
Nut Material: Synthetic Bone,
Bridge/Tailpiece: 4-saddle American Vintage,
Tuners: American Vintage Reverse Open-gear,
Middle Pickup: Vintera Vintage-style '50s Split Single-coil,
Controls: 1 x master volume, 1 x master tone,
Strings: Fender NPS, .045-.105,
Case Included: Gig Bag,
Manufacturer Part Number: 0149612373, 0149612354,

I had to spoil myself and get this new vintera 50s precision bass. I love how sweetwater photographs and weighs each individual guitar so if you want, you can choose which one you want based on weight and looks. My 50s p has a gorgeous AAA flamed maple neck which would be at least a 200 dollar premium, by luck of the lumber. This is why the guitar gallery here at sweetwater is the read more best!. I got a 9 pound even alder body. I think only the blonde is ash(which i would prefer). Because it was cold during the shipping all the way here in Texas, the bass only needed a slight truss rod adjustment and the saddles needed to be flush with the bridge(not to disturb the radius). Only 2 saddle basses and 3 saddle guitar bridges need to have the saddles themselves match the neck radius because each string isn't able to adjust up and down individually. The new redesigned Tim Shaw pickup sounds awesome! Very nice sound especially through my 59 bassman ltd(eminence bass speakers). I wish it came with the pickgaurd pre drilled for the covers and the rest included but thats another 60 bucks if you really want it(i do). I also adjusted the pickup heights to my liking. Didn't have to intonate and it might just be me but fender strings that come installed from the factory are extra bright and last longer than the ones they sell normally.

Being a full grown adult and having spent some time starting out on a Gretsch short scale , I decided to up grade. I love the rugged simplicity of this instrument. It's vintage style neck shape and 7.25 radius fretboard are fast and very forgiving so the short scale is stored away now and my future is P bass. The only change I have made is addition of a Hipshot chrome thumb rest read more ( was lost without a nice big humbucker thumb rest). Did not have to feel bad about drilling 1 hole in a MIM instrument using excellent instructions on the Fender web site. This is the only bass I found with these specifications and this great early P bass sound.
